Clinical Business Analyst
About the Role:
The Clinical Business Analyst serves as a key liaison between clinical operations, business stakeholders, and technical teams to optimize lab benefit management strategies. This role combines clinical knowledge with analytical expertise to assess, interpret, and translate business and healthcare data into actionable insights that support evidence-based decision-making, improve utilization management, and enhance operational efficiency.
The Clinical Business Analyst will be responsible for gathering and documenting business requirements, identifying trends in lab test utilization, developing reports and dashboards, and supporting the implementation of clinical and policy initiatives. This position requires strong analytical thinking, healthcare domain expertiseparticularly in laboratory testingand the ability to communicate complex information effectively across multidisciplinary teams. Candidate must be proficient in written and verbal communication, proficient in SQL, knowledgeable of database structures, SDLC, reporting tools and JIRA/JQL.
This position is eligible for remote work, but quarterly travel will be required to the corporate office located in Tampa, Florida.
